Correction to: miR-205-5p inhibits human endometriosis progression by targeting ANGPT2 in endometrial stromal cells
This paper is an amendment to a previously published study concerning miR-205-5p's role in inhibiting endometriosis progression by targeting ANGPT2 in endometrial stromal cells.

This correction article addresses an error in the original 2019 study investigating miR-205-5p in endometriosis. Specifically, it states that in sub-panel A of Fig. 1, the blue and red threshold values were mistakenly reversed, and provides the corrected version of that figure panel. It does not report new experiments or additional findings beyond rectifying the figure labeling. This paper is centrally about endometriosis — it corrects a previously published endometriosis figure related to miR-205-5p and ectopic versus normal endometrium comparisons.
